Through Art in Public Places, the Anton Art Center seeks to enhance the City of Mount Clemens by integrating artwork into the downtown streetscapes:
- County Seat by Gary Kulak; installed August 3, 1999 - at the corner of Walnut Street and Cass Avenue
- Guardian by Albert Young; installed September 29, 1999 - in front of Community Central Bank at the corner of Market and Main Streets
- Conceptual Seats by Lois Teicher; installed March 10, 2000 - at the corner of Pine Street and Macomb Place
- Apple of My Eye by Janice Trimpe; installed May 12, 2000 - on Macomb Place near North Walnut Street
- Galileo's Night Vision by Joseph Wesner, installed October 31, 2002 - at the corner of Market and Main Streets
